<h3>What are ScreenTips?</h3>
ScreenTips is known to be a term that connote a small windows that shows any kind of descriptive text if a person place the pointer on a command or on a control.
Note that Enhanced ScreenTips are found to be bigger windows that shows a lot of descriptive text than a ScreenTip.
